contents The notion of rigour relevant to the practice of physics is an endogenous one. Theoretical physics has its own internal norms about mathematical practice and notions of legitimate derivations or formal objects. These norms are often implicit, local, and change in substantial ways over time. Moreover, norms of rigour in theoretical physics, at least in the mid-twentieth century, are primarily focused on the goal of removing barriers for concrete calculation and clear conceptualisation. Rather than pursuit of rigour for its own sake, or to achieve some `higher' standard of truth, theoretical physicists seek to `rigorise' initial, semi-formal constructions in order to render formally well-defined models with which they can make concrete contact with the world, through calculations of quantities of interest. In what follows we will support this thesis based upon a detailed historical case study of the development of and attribution of credit for the Wheeler-DeWitt equation in the period 1962-67. Drawing upon archival material and the published record we develop and defend the explanatory hypothesis that it was the rigorisation of the equation via the expression for the inner product that was the crucial step in the work of Wheeler and DeWitt rather than the statement of the equation itself.
